Gators Rally To Win Over South Carolina

The Florida Gators (5-2, 3-1) defeated South Carolina (2-4, 1-3) 41-39 on Saturday afternoon in South Carolina.

A back and forth first first half ended when the Gators led South Carolina 24-21 at halftime. Both teams exchanged field goals in the third quarter, before South Carolina scored two touchdowns early in the fourth quarter to build a 37-27 lead.

However, the Gators would rally - Graham Mertz hit Arlis Boardingham for a 4-yard touchdown with 4:40 left to pull within three. Then Mertz hit Ricky Pearsall for a 21-yard touchdown pass with fourty-seven seconds to go in the game that gave Florida a 41-37 lead.

The Gamecocks got two points back on a safety with four seconds left, but the Gators held onto a 41-39 lead win.

Mertz finished the game with 423 yards through the air and three passing touchdowns. Trevor Etienne added a score on the ground while rushing for 49 yards.

The Gators return to action next week when they face #1 Georgia in the World's Largest Cocktail Party on October 28th.
